Transaction 2415624698fddbde31cf61da700bcca747496a13a5462ab150ce19758209eaf9

1 Input
2 Outputs
  • 2415624698fddbde31cf61da700bcca747496a13a5462ab150ce19758209eaf9:0
  • value  860484
    address  3JXBQPpZd9VHnCr2bZX6h55Z33rr61tByv
  • 2415624698fddbde31cf61da700bcca747496a13a5462ab150ce19758209eaf9:1
  • value  47763071
    address  1KSM82jmr8J3LPMD3SsycWs1pzMbTWZZP5